The method used to extract a metal from its ore depends upon the stability of its compound in the ore, which in turn depends upon the reactivity of the metal:. So, the method of extraction of a metal from its ore depends on the metal's position in the reactivity series. The table displays some metals in decreasing order of reactivity and the methods used to extract them.

We can see from the table that reactive metals, such as aluminium, are extracted by electrolysis , while a less reactive metal, such as iron, may be extracted by reduction with carbon. Because gold it is so unreactive, it is found as the native metal and not as a compound. It does not need to be chemically separated.

However , chemical reactions may be needed to remove other elements that might contaminate the metal. Elemental barium does not have many practical uses, again due to its high level of reactivity. However, its strong attraction to oxygen makes it useful as a "getter" to remove the last traces of air in vacuum tubes.

Pure barium can also be combined with other metals to form alloys that are used to make machine elements such as bearings or spark plugs in internal combustion engines. Because barium has a loose hold on its electrons, its alloys emit electrons easily when heated and improve the efficiency of the spark plugs, according to Krebs. Compounds containing barium have a variety of commercial uses. Barium sulfate, or barite, is used in lithopone a brightening pigment in printer paper and paint , oil well drilling fluids, glassmaking and creating rubber.

Barium carbonate is used as a rat poison, and barium nitrate and barium chlorate produce green colors in fireworks.

The average adult contains about 22 mg of barium because it is present in foods such as carrots, onions , lettuce, beans, and cereal grains. Barium levels in your teeth can actually help scientists determine when babies transition from breast-feeding to eating solid foods.

These low levels of barium serve no biological role and are not harmful. Barium can cause vomiting, colic, diarrhea, tremors and paralysis. There have been a handful of murders with barium compounds, including a murder of a man in Mansfield, Texas, by his year-old daughter, Marie Robards , who stole barium acetate from her high school chemistry laboratory.

Several patients were also accidentally killed by barium when soluble barium carbonate rather than insoluble barium sulfate was mistakenly used during a gastroenterological GI diagnostic test called a barium enema. Doctors perform barium enemas in order to visualize and diagnose abnormalities of the large intestine and rectum, according to Johns Hopkins Medicine. During the procedure, barium sulfate is instilled via the rectum to coat the inner walls of the large intestine.

Air is typically administered next to make sure the barium coating fills all surface abnormalities. Then, X-rays are used to produce an image of the lower GI tract. Barium sulfate absorbs X-rays and appears white on the X-ray film, in contrast to the air and surrounding tissue that appear black.

Analysis of the X-ray image from the barium enema enables physicians to diagnose disorders such as ulcerative colitis, Crohn's disease, polyps, cancer, and irritable bowel syndrome.
